Comments (15)

  • Associate 2 in Consulting
Jun 4, 2021 - 1:29pm

Yes, financial and other modeling is part of strategy consulting

In terms of the most technical stuff you'll have to do there's a high variance. I know people who are consistently using fairly advanced analytics platforms, and I also know people who have never opened Excel except to write down lists of names. I'd say the average is a mix of Excel, Tableau, and occasion Alteryx

Is there a particular reason you're asking?

  • Associate 2 in Consulting
Jun 4, 2021 - 1:41pm

Knowing how to use Excel and do some modeling is never a bad idea, but you aren't expected to have any particular technical skills before you join

Some companies will use Excel type tests in interviews, but I have not heard of MBB using them

Jun 4, 2021 - 2:03pm

Do learn excel / take an excel course if you can. I did this before starting and it has been immensely helpful. 

Don't take a financial modeling course. I've taken one of these as well as preparation for a previous finance internship. They focus on the kind of modeling you would do in banking. You would use these kinds of models very rarely if at all in consulting so the ROI would be low if not zero. 

In general, I found the excel course helped me much more than the financial modeling course, even for financial modeling. 

Jun 4, 2021 - 2:06pm

To answer your question about the 'most technical' thing in consulting, we have people who do work in /with Python / machine learning / data science. The ceiling on how 'technical' you can get in consulting is actually much higher than it is in banking, which I feel like is rarely acknowledged in these types of forums. 

If you want to do that kind of work I would learn some of it before starting so it's easier to get staffed in roles where you would be using those skills

Jun 4, 2021 - 2:15pm

I'd challenge the idea that these are separate paths. They are to an extent, but our more technical teams are being brought on to projects with increasing frequency. Which makes intuitive sense-if you have methods of more rigorous / advanced analysis, you would want to break those out wherever possible. 

Personally, I am working to develop a more technical toolkit so my staffing can be more flexible, not less. Someone who knows Python or SQL or any other technical skill can still be staffed on a more qualitative / slide heavy project where they don't use those skills, whereas someone without those skills is more limited

